Ok here's Zinga ratings. I use the AE-03AZL on My Auxiliary System, The chart shows that filter will get 50% of 5mics & 98.7% of 24mics on the first pass and it will absorb 7.2oz of water, the more water it absorbs, the bigger the restriction until it curtail 100% of the flow, I ask at what PSI that rating used, their reply is that the best the filter can do up to 50PSI.

You legally cannot sell this filter for direct injection filter certification (Combustion fuel delivery), Its possible to curtail the flow 100% , Fed law prohibits this..This clearly shows that and spin-on must have bypass ability, the canister filters get by this by allowing x% to bypass 100% of the time. You want your canister filter to be the final filtration to combustion to assist the secondary filter, and the more filters prior to the final filter canister the cleaner the combustion fuel.
